from __future__ import annotations
import asyncio
import logging
import random
import time
from datetime import timedelta
from http import HTTPStatus
from typing import TYPE_CHECKING, Any, TypeVar
import impit
from apify_client._consts import (
DEFAULT_MAX_RETRIES,
DEFAULT_MIN_DELAY_BETWEEN_RETRIES,
DEFAULT_TIMEOUT_LONG,
DEFAULT_TIMEOUT_MAX,
DEFAULT_TIMEOUT_MEDIUM,
DEFAULT_TIMEOUT_SHORT,
)
from apify_client._docs import docs_group
from apify_client._logging import log_context, logger_name
from apify_client._utils import to_seconds
from apify_client.errors import ApifyApiError, InvalidResponseBodyError
from apify_client.http_clients._base import HttpClient, HttpClientAsync
if TYPE_CHECKING:
from collections.abc import Awaitable, Callable
from apify_client._statistics import ClientStatistics
from apify_client.http_clients._base import HttpResponse
from apify_client.types import JsonSerializable, Timeout
T = TypeVar('T')
logger = logging.getLogger(logger_name)
def _is_retryable_error(exc: Exception) -> bool:
"""Check if an exception represents a transient error that should be retried.
All `impit.HTTPError` subclasses are considered retryable because they represent transport-level failures
(network issues, timeouts, protocol errors, body decoding errors) that are typically transient. HTTP status
code errors are handled separately in `_make_request` based on the response status code, not here.
"""
return isinstance(
exc,
(
InvalidResponseBodyError,
impit.HTTPError,
),
)
@docs_group('HTTP clients')
class ImpitHttpClient(HttpClient):
"""Synchronous HTTP client for the Apify API built on top of [Impit](https://github.com/apify/impit).
Impit is a high-performance HTTP client written in Rust that provides browser-like TLS fingerprints,
automatic header ordering, and HTTP/2 support. This client wraps `impit.Client` and adds automatic retries
with exponential backoff for rate-limited (HTTP 429) and server error (HTTP 5xx) responses.
"""
def __init__(
self,
*,
token: str | None = None,
timeout_short: timedelta = DEFAULT_TIMEOUT_SHORT,
timeout_medium: timedelta = DEFAULT_TIMEOUT_MEDIUM,
timeout_long: timedelta = DEFAULT_TIMEOUT_LONG,
timeout_max: timedelta = DEFAULT_TIMEOUT_MAX,
max_retries: int = DEFAULT_MAX_RETRIES,
min_delay_between_retries: timedelta = DEFAULT_MIN_DELAY_BETWEEN_RETRIES,
statistics: ClientStatistics | None = None,
headers: dict[str, str] | None = None,
) -> None:
"""Initialize the Impit-based synchronous HTTP client.
Args:
token: Apify API token for authentication.
timeout_short: Default timeout for short-duration API operations (simple CRUD operations, ...).
timeout_medium: Default timeout for medium-duration API operations (batch operations, listing, ...).
timeout_long: Default timeout for long-duration API operations (long-polling, streaming, ...).
timeout_max: Maximum timeout cap for exponential timeout growth across retries.
max_retries: Maximum number of retry attempts for failed requests.
min_delay_between_retries: Minimum delay between retries (increases exponentially with each attempt).
statistics: Statistics tracker for API calls. Created automatically if not provided.
headers: Additional HTTP headers to include in all requests.
"""
super().__init__(
token=token,
timeout_short=timeout_short,
timeout_medium=timeout_medium,
timeout_long=timeout_long,
timeout_max=timeout_max,
max_retries=max_retries,
min_delay_between_retries=min_delay_between_retries,
statistics=statistics,
headers=headers,
)
self._impit_client = impit.Client(
headers=self._headers,
follow_redirects=True,
)
def call(
self,
*,
method: str,
url: str,
headers: dict[str, str] | None = None,
params: dict[str, Any] | None = None,
data: str | bytes | bytearray | None = None,
json: JsonSerializable | None = None,
stream: bool | None = None,
timeout: Timeout = 'medium',
) -> HttpResponse:
"""Make an HTTP request with automatic retry and exponential backoff.
Args:
method: HTTP method (GET, POST, PUT, DELETE, etc.).
url: Full URL to make the request to.
headers: Additional headers to include.
params: Query parameters to append to the URL.
data: Raw request body data. Cannot be used together with json.
json: JSON-serializable data for the request body. Cannot be used together with data.
stream: Whether to stream the response body.
timeout: Timeout for the API HTTP request. Use `short`, `medium`, or `long` tier literals for
preconfigured timeouts. A `timedelta` overrides it for this call, and `no_timeout` disables
the timeout entirely.
Returns:
The HTTP response object.
Raises:
ApifyApiError: If the request fails after all retries or returns a non-retryable error status.
ValueError: If both json and data are provided.
"""
log_context.method.set(method)
log_context.url.set(url)
self._statistics.calls += 1
prepared_headers, prepared_params, content = self._prepare_request_call(
headers=headers,
params=params,
data=data,
json=json,
)
return self._retry_with_exp_backoff(
lambda stop_retrying, attempt: self._make_request(
stop_retrying=stop_retrying,
attempt=attempt,
method=method,
url=url,
headers=prepared_headers,
params=prepared_params,
content=content,
stream=stream,
timeout=timeout,
),
max_retries=self._max_retries,
backoff_base=self._min_delay_between_retries,
)
def _make_request(
self,
*,
stop_retrying: Callable[[], None],
attempt: int,
method: str,
url: str,
headers: dict[str, str],
params: dict[str, Any] | None,
content: bytes | None,
stream: bool | None,
timeout: Timeout,
) -> impit.Response:
"""Execute a single HTTP request attempt.
Args:
stop_retrying: Callback to signal that retries should stop.
attempt: Current attempt number (1-indexed).
method: HTTP method.
url: Request URL.
headers: Request headers.
params: Query parameters.
content: Request body content.
stream: Whether to stream the response.
timeout: Timeout for this request.
Returns:
The HTTP response object.
Raises:
ApifyApiError: If the request fails with an error status.
"""
log_context.attempt.set(attempt)
logger.debug('Sending request')
self._statistics.requests += 1
try:
url_with_params = self._build_url_with_params(url, params=params)
# Impit treats timeout=None as "use client default (30s)", not "no timeout".
# Use a large value (24 hours) to effectively disable the timeout.
# This can be removed once impit updates its behaviour: https://github.com/apify/impit/issues/401
computed_timeout = self._compute_timeout(timeout, attempt=attempt)
impit_timeout = 86_400 if computed_timeout is None else computed_timeout
response = self._impit_client.request(
method=method,
url=url_with_params,
headers=headers,
content=content,
timeout=impit_timeout,
stream=stream or False,
)
if response.status_code < HTTPStatus.MULTIPLE_CHOICES:
logger.debug('Request successful', extra={'status_code': response.status_code})
return response
if response.status_code == HTTPStatus.TOO_MANY_REQUESTS:
self._statistics.add_rate_limit_error(attempt)
except Exception as exc:
logger.debug('Request threw exception', exc_info=exc)
if not _is_retryable_error(exc):
logger.debug('Exception is not retryable', exc_info=exc)
stop_retrying()
raise
# Retry only server errors (5xx) and rate limits (429).
logger.debug('Request unsuccessful', extra={'status_code': response.status_code})
if (
response.status_code < HTTPStatus.INTERNAL_SERVER_ERROR
and response.status_code != HTTPStatus.TOO_MANY_REQUESTS
):
logger.debug('Status code is not retryable', extra={'status_code': response.status_code})
stop_retrying()
# Read the response in case it is a stream, so we can raise the error properly.
response.read()
raise ApifyApiError(response, attempt, method=method)
@staticmethod
def _retry_with_exp_backoff(
func: Callable[[Callable[[], None], int], T],
*,
max_retries: int = 8,
backoff_base: timedelta = timedelta(milliseconds=500),
backoff_factor: float = 2,
random_factor: float = 1,
) -> T:
"""Retry a function with exponential backoff and jitter.
Args:
func: Function to retry. Receives (stop_retrying callback, attempt number).
max_retries: Maximum retry attempts.
backoff_base: Base delay.
backoff_factor: Exponential multiplier (clamped to 1-10).
random_factor: Jitter factor (clamped to 0-1).
Returns:
The function's return value on success.
Raises:
Exception: Re-raises the last exception if all retries fail or stop_retrying is called.
"""
if max_retries < 1:
raise ValueError(f'max_retries must be at least 1, got {max_retries}')
random_factor = min(max(0, random_factor), 1)
backoff_factor = min(max(1, backoff_factor), 10)
swallow = True
def stop_retrying() -> None:
nonlocal swallow
swallow = False
for attempt in range(1, max_retries + 1):
try:
return func(stop_retrying, attempt)
except Exception:
if not swallow:
raise
random_sleep_factor = random.uniform(1, 1 + random_factor)
backoff_base_secs = to_seconds(backoff_base)
backoff_exp_factor = backoff_factor ** (attempt - 1)
sleep_time_secs = random_sleep_factor * backoff_base_secs * backoff_exp_factor
time.sleep(sleep_time_secs)
return func(stop_retrying, max_retries + 1)
